FAQs

1. What is the shelf life of this Thallium ICP standard?

The standard remains stable for 24 months from the date of manufacture when stored unopened at 15-25°C. Once opened, use within 6 months for optimal accuracy.

2. Can this standard be used with both ICP-OES and ICP-MS?

Yes, the 1000 ppm concentration is suitable for dilution to working ranges compatible with both ICP-OES and ICP-MS instrumentation.

3. What diluent is recommended for preparing lower concentration standards?

Use 2% nitric acid (HNO₃) prepared from ultra-pure reagents to maintain matrix consistency and prevent precipitation.

4. How should I dispose of unused Thallium standard solution?

Collect waste in a dedicated heavy metal container and dispose through authorized hazardous waste handlers following local environmental regulations.
